How to get from Gainesville to Dumfries by bus?
By bus
To get from Gainesville to Dumfries in Washington, D.C. - Baltimore, MD, you’ll need to take 3 bus lines: take the 61 bus from Limestone Commuter Lot station to Cushing Commuter Lot station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the 611 bus and finally take the MC-100 bus from 14th St @ F St Nw station to Route 234 Commuter Lot station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 6 hr 17 min. The ride fare is $27.60.
